About this map

The Browns Gulch Mining District and high-altitude rangelands of southwestern Montana define this landscape as it was documented in the late 1940s. Centered on the Gravelly Range, the map details a rugged transition from the Madison River valley in the northeast to the Ruby River in the southwest. Mining activity remains prominent in the northwest, where sites like the Easton-Pacific Mine, Marietta Mine, and Garrison Mine dot the drainages near Baldy Mtn.
